site stats

Circular linked list vs doubly linked list

WebJul 27, 2024 · Due to the fact that a circular doubly linked list contains three parts in its structure therefore, it demands more space per node and more expensive basic … WebAug 21, 2024 · The difference between singly and doubly linked list on the basis of traversal is that in singly linked list we can only traverse in forward direction whereas in doubly linked list we can traverse in both forward and backward direction. Previous LinkedList listiterator () method in Java Next

Maximum Element in a Linked List - Dot Net Tutorials

Web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um Element in a Linked List using C Language with Examples.Please read our previous article, where we discussed the Sum of all elements in a Linked List using C Language with … WebFeb 2, 2024 · A node in a doubly circular linked list contains a data item and two node pointers, one to the previous node and one to the next node. In doubly linked list we can traverse in both direction. Here ... tts ios https://brainardtechnology.com

Types of Linked List - Programiz

WebApr 10, 2024 · A doubly circular linked list (DCL) is a variation of the standard doubly linked list. In a DCL, the first and last nodes are linked together, forming a circle. This allows for quick and easy traversal of the … WebSep 16, 2024 · A circular doubly linked list is a data structure that consists of a collection of nodes, where each node contains a data element and two pointers: one that points to the next node in the list and another that points to the previous node in the list. WebA circular linked list is a type of linked list in which the first and the last nodes are also connected to each other to form a circle. There are basically two types of circular linked … phoenix to laughlin drive

Types of Linked List – Singly-linked, doubly linked, and …

Category:Binary Trees vs. Linked Lists vs. Hash Tables - Baeldung

Tags:Circular linked list vs doubly linked list

Circular linked list vs doubly linked list

What is difference between circular and doubly linked list?

WebDec 14, 2024 · For more information, see Sequenced Singly Linked Lists. Doubly Linked Lists. The operating system provides built-in support for doubly linked lists that use LIST_ENTRY structures. A doubly linked list consists of a list head plus some number of list entries. (The number of list entries is zero if the list is empty.) WebJun 13, 2024 · Doubly Circularly Linked Lists. The final of the three, which incorporates all the features into one, is the DCLL. This stores the same things as a normal DLL but instead of having the null value in the start and end, those will point to each other to make it circular, just like the SCLL. That’s a lot to take in, let’s take it piece by piece.

Circular linked list vs doubly linked list

Did you know?

WebMar 22, 2024 · A circular linked list can be a singly linked list or a doubly linked list. In a doubly circular linked list, the previous pointer of the first node is connected to the last node while the next pointer of the last node is connected to the first node. Its representation is shown below. Declaration WebJan 10, 2024 · Why Circular linked list? In a singly linked list, for accessing any node of the linked list, we start traversing from the first node. If we are at any node in the middle of the list, then it is not possible to access nodes that precede the given node. This problem can be solved by slightly altering the structure of a singly linked list.

WebCircularly linked lists are useful to traverse an entire list starting at any point. In a linear linked list, it is required to know the head pointer to traverse the entire list. The linear linked list cannot be traversed completely with the help of an intermediate pointer. WebThe main difference between the doubly linked list and doubly circular linked list is that the doubly circular linked list does not contain the NULL value in the previous field of …

WebFeb 23, 2024 · A Doubly linked list is used in navigation systems or to represent a classic deck of cards. A Doubly linked list is a bidirectional linked list; i.e., you can traverse it from head to tail node or tail to head node. Unlike singly-linked lists, its node has an extra pointer that points at the last node. WebCircular doubly linked list is a more complexed type of data structure in which a node contain pointers to its previous node as well as the next node. Circular doubly linked …

WebSingly linked linear lists vs. other lists. While doubly linked and circular lists have advantages over singly linked linear lists, linear lists offer some advantages that make them preferable in some situations. A singly linked linear list is a recursive data structure, because it contains a pointer to a smaller object of the same type.

WebAnswer: Hi, See you ll find a lots of technical answer in google and many books for this as i found but still those answers didnt make my doubt clear about difference between … tts insideWebWhile doubly linked and circular lists have advantages over singly linked linear lists, linear lists offer some advantages that make them preferable in some situations. A singly … tt skinsuit cyclingWebIn the next article, I am going to discuss Linear Search in a Linked List using C Language with Examples. Here, in this article, I try to explain Finding Maximum Element in a … tts in textWebNov 28,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. tts in powerpointWebA circular linked list is a type of linked list in which the first and the last nodes are also connected to each other to form a circle. There are basically two types of circular linked list: 1. Circular Singly Linked List. Here, the address of the last node consists of the address of the first node. Circular Linked List Representation. phoenix to las vegas flightsWebThe singly linked list simple, whereas the doubly linked list, is a complex dynamic data structure of the list. The doubly linked list provides an empty head and tail pointer. Hence, a singly linked list provides an empty tail only. … phoenix to lake powell azWebBoth Singly linked list and Doubly linked list are the executions of a Linked list. The singly-linked list holds data and a link to the next component. While in a doubly-linked … tts irs form